The term “entourage effect” was coined by Mechoulam and Shimon Ben-Shabat within a cannabinoid study from 1999. From the review, Mechoulam and Shabat advised this phenomenon describes why botanical medication (containing the whole spectrum of compounds within a plant) can often be more effective than the plant’s isolated factors.
